Drone Strike Hits Kuwait-Iraq Border Crossing, Causing Material Damage

 

Abdali crossing temporarily closed after attack as Kuwaiti forces secure site

A drone attack targeted Kuwait’s Abdali border crossing with Iraq on Thursday, causing material damage but no casualties, the Kuwaiti Army said.

Kuwaiti Ministry of Defense spokesperson Saud Abdulaziz Al-Atwan said the border facility was struck around noon by “hostile drones.”

He added that specialised teams immediately responded to the incident, securing the area and coordinating with relevant authorities to assess the damage and ensure public safety.

Inspection and explosive ordnance disposal teams from the Kuwaiti Land Force examined the site, removed drone debris and confirmed that the area was clear of any further threats.

The incident comes amid rising regional tensions, with several Gulf countries facing increased security concerns linked to ongoing exchanges of missile and drone attacks in the region.
